PNUR 1321 — – Nursing Care of the Mentally Ill

1 credits · 1 hours

This course introduces basic concepts of mental health and nursing care of the mentally ill. Defense mechanisms, mental disorders, and substance abuse are discussed. Resources and rehabilitation are stressed. A grade of "C" or better is required for passing. Hours: 16 Lecture Hours Prerequisite(s): HEALTH PROFESSIONS faculty permission Corequisite(s): PNUR 1317 and PNUR 1138 Offered: Fall, Spring
